1989 Ford Thunderbird vs. 1995 Opel Calibra

To start off, 1995 Opel Calibra is newer by 6 year(s). Which means there will be less support and parts availability for 1989 Ford Thunderbird. In addition, the cost of maintenance, including insurance, on 1989 Ford Thunderbird would be higher. At 3,791 cc (6 cylinders), 1989 Ford Thunderbird is equipped with a bigger engine. In terms of performance, 1989 Ford Thunderbird (138 HP @ 3800 RPM) has 23 more horse power than 1995 Opel Calibra. (115 HP @ 5200 RPM). In normal driving conditions, 1989 Ford Thunderbird should accelerate faster than 1995 Opel Calibra. With that said, vehicle weight also plays an important factor in acceleration. 1989 Ford Thunderbird weights approximately 424 kg more than 1995 Opel Calibra. So despite on having greater horse power, its additional weight may have an impact towards its acceleration in comparison.

Let's talk about torque, 1989 Ford Thunderbird (291 Nm @ 2400 RPM) has 121 more torque (in Nm) than 1995 Opel Calibra. (170 Nm @ 2600 RPM). This means 1989 Ford Thunderbird will have an easier job in driving up hills or pulling heavy equipment than 1995 Opel Calibra.
